An indirect rollover , also called a 60-working day rollover, is a person in which you personally just take possession on the funds ahead of putting them back into an IRA within the 60-working day window.

One example is, you take a distribution by check and deposit All those funds into a personal bank account. You then produce a check from that account and deliver it towards your new IRA supplier within sixty days from the First distribution to deposit for your account- this is really an indirect rollover.
